  • The Packer Collegiate Institute, a vibrant PK-12 Grade independent school located in Brooklyn, NY, seeks a dedicated and enthusiastic Associate Teacher to work in PK3 for the 2026/27 school year.
  • The role offers an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ience in an engaging, collaborative learning environment that emphasizes academic excellence, creativity, and student well-being.
  • Associate Teachers are regarded as teachers-in-training, and their role and responsibilities grow as they gain experience and knowledge.
  • Associate Teachers typically remain at Packer for two years, with a potential extension for a third year.
  • Start Date: August 26, 2026 Key Responsibilities: Collaborate with the Head Teacher to plan and implement rich, engaging, and developmentally appropriate learning opportunities across subject areas Support the academic, social, and emotional growth of students by providing individualized and small-group instruction.
  • In partnership with Head Teacher, co-teach and lead full group learning Facilitate a positive, inclusive classroom environment that fosters curiosity, collaboration, and respect Assist in classroom management and organization, ensuring a safe, productive, and intentional learning space.
  • Support students during transitions Participate in assessment and documentation, and contribute to tracking student progress and development Communicate effectively with students, colleagues, and families, fostering strong partnerships Participate in school events, meetings, and professional development opportunities Step into the Head Teacher role when necessary, ensuring continuity of instruction and care Supervise and engage students during play and learning to ensure a safe and inclusive environment.
  • Facilitate conflict resolution and collaborative problem-solving as needed Qualifications and Skills: Bachelor’s degree required; degree in Education or a related field preferred Interest in pursuing a career in education and a strong passion for working with young learners Prior experience with children in educational or similar settings Excellent communication, interpersonal, and organizational skills A commitment to fostering di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ging in the classroom Flexibility, enthusiasm, and a growth-oriented learning mindset Physical Requirements: The physical requirements for faculty (both Associate and Head Teachers) align with the physical demands of working with young children.
  • Generally, the role requires 25% sitting, 25% walking, and 50% standing.
  • Mobility/Dexterity: Ability to move around the classroom, bend, kneel, squat, and sit on the floor to interact with students at their level for extended periods Ability to lift and carry children or objects weighing up to 25–50 pounds (e.g., a child needing assistance, classroom materials, etc.) Ability to move freely indoors and outdoors, including navigating playgrounds, sidewalks, and nature-based learning areas Ability to keep track of multiple children simultaneously and respond to their needs promptly Competent hand-eye coordination to manipulate small objects, loose parts, craft materials, scissors, and writing tools.
  • Ability to help children with tasks such as tying shoes, zipping jackets, or assisting with toileting needs (if required) Stamina: Ability to stand or walk for extended periods.
  • Ability to maintain energy throughout a school day (which can involve teaching, supervising recess, and leading physical activities) Classroom and Activity-Specific Tasks Classroom Setup and Maintenance: Rearranging desks, chairs, and other classroom furniture Preparing bulletin boards or displays, which might involve climbing a small step ladder Outdoor Activities: Supervising and sometimes participating in outdoor play (in a variety of weather), which may include running, walking, and ensuring safety during physical play Emergency Response: Reacting quickly in emergencies to assist students, evacuate the classroom, or provide basic first aid Why Join Us?
  • Be part of a supportive and collaborative teaching community that values your contributions and encourages professional growth Access opportunities for mentorship and professional development, including pathways to becoming a Head Teacher Work in a dynamic and innovative school environment that emphasizes holistic development for both students and educators Opportunities to take on additional stipended roles Full benefits package Reasonable Accommodations: To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ily.
